Aprašymas

A new critical edition of Apuleius' philosophical works, covering De Deo Socratis, De Platone et eius dogmate, and De mundo.

Draws on a new collation of the ancient manuscripts and scrupulous investigation of all previous editions

Presents improved solutions for many textual problems, enhanced manuscript readings, and individuation of previously unnoticed corruptions and marginal notes

Includes a rich but selective critical apparatus and a Latin praefatio with a comprehensive and up-to-date bibliography and critical survey of printed editions from the princeps (1469) onwards
